1. Unless the Parties agree otherwise, if a matter referred to in Article 29.4 has not been resolved within:
(a) 45 days of the date of receipt of the request for consultations; or
(b) 25 days of the date of receipt of the request for consultations for matters referred to in Article 29.4.4, the requesting Party may refer the matter to an arbitration panel by providing its written request for the establishment of an arbitration panel to the responding Party.
2. The requesting Party shall identify in its written notice the specific measure at issue and the legal basis for the complaint, including an explanation of how such measure constitutes a breach of the provisions referred to in Article 29.2.
